Nursing is hard at first.
"Consider a breastfeeding class although you are pregnant," says Melissa Kotlen Nagin, a lactation advisor in Larchmont, Ny. But additionally be ready to seek out assist when little one arrives. "Getting child to latch on might not truly feel normal," Nagin says. "Ask for guide while in the hospital." 

We're not likely to lie. Individuals initial days, you could really feel what professionals phone excessive tenderness -- and what we get in touch with ache. But when your infant is effectively latched, discomfort should really diminish all through just about every nursing session and go away fully with time. Never disregard shooting ache; a knot inside the breast accompanied by soreness and redness may very well be a plugged milk duct, which could result in mastitis, a nasty infection that usually requires antibiotics. Ninety % of moms who speak to La Leche League are anxious about both latch or provide. The good news is, lactation consultants make residence calls, hospitals host clinics, as well as World wide web delivers numerous sources. My daughter's pediatrician just showed me the way to change my child's chin to enhance her lazy suck.

You happen to be the foods provide, so mom on your own.
Hold taking prenatal nutritional vitamins, get ample calcium, and drink no less than 64 ounces of water every day even though nursing. "A new mom has to remain effectively hydrated and very well fed," says Jane Crouse, a La Leche League leader and mom of 3. You will require an additional 300 to 500 calories every day. You will also will need to find out to loosen up, having said that it is possible to -- tension could possibly have an effect on letdown (the commence of the milk movement). Consider a warm shower, sink right into a chair, and try to remember to breathe while you enable your squirmy little one latch on. 

In case you desire medicine (for anything at all from a cold to a continual affliction), examine together with your health care provider. Most meds -- but not all -- are fine in breast milk. Likewise, one particular drink every single when inside a although is risk-free. Have it a minimum of two hrs just before a feeding so the alcohol can depart your program.

Lots of females pump milk, and for all sorts of motives.
Very first, some females pump both to motivate their milk provide or to alleviate engorgement. If little one includes a fantastic night's rest so you wake up filled with milk, it's possible you'll at the same time bottle it for long term use! 

2nd, one can find the occasional pumpers. Fill a bottle, and Dad can do that midnight feed, otherwise you can possess a baby-free date. For this, chances are you'll want only just one guide pump.

Last but not least, there are actually doing work moms who consider two or 3 quick breaks throughout the workday to pump breast milk, which they deliver house and place while in the fridge or freezer. If you'd prefer to do that, talk about your intentions along with your boss or seek the advice of one other mom in the enterprise that has finished it, to generate certain you will have room and privacy. A particular hands-free bra can permit you to multitask -- answering e-mail or reading through although you pump. Invest in the double electrical pump to velocity important things along.
